In sports; who do you pick, and why?Posted by Amir Ibrahim in Untagged |
|
Just off from watching the tennis chamionships at Wimbledon. Was with a rather large group of people and I was surprised at the passion with which we were supporting or opposing the players. I mean, what are the stakes, what is in it for us?
Most tournaments there is a national, racial or such other affiliation that guides viewer preferences, but that was absent this weekend, at least in the main finals ( ladies, Serena versus Venus Williams and gentlemen, Roger Federer versus Rafael Nadal. Still that did not stop the passionate supporters from declaring that Venus was elegant and lady-like and Serena brutish and manly, or that Nadal was uncouth and unwashed, while Federer was all the gentleman. Even the commentators seemed to be dragged in, declaring that the heart was for Venus and Nadal, but the mind was for Serena and Federer.
In the event, Venus overcame her sister in a somewhat boring match (hearts over mind) and Federer was vanquished by his nemesis Nadal (mind victorious this time around).
